Man who blocked hospital exit expected in court
Posted: 10.27.2008 at 4:19 PM
0

FLORENCE, S.C. (AP) -- An armed man who blocked a hospital emergency room exit for about 16 hours in Conway could soon learn whether he'll be given bond.

The Sun News of Myrtle Beach reports that 42-year-old Robert McGowan was expected in court Monday for a bond and probable cause hearing. McGowan is charged with having a weapon as a felon.

Authorities say McGowan threatened to kill himself while barricaded in his car Oct. 21, but it's unknown why he drove to Conway Medical Center armed with a .22-caliber rifle. He surrendered to police after the overnight standoff. No one was injured.

McGowan was on two years' probation after serving 10 years in prison for shooting a Horry County police officer in the hand in 1996.
